Standardise DB Job names

Standardise the DB creation job name to service-db-init for all services.
This commit is contained in:
Pete Birley 2017-01-22 05:45:30 +00:00
parent 2d5fd2da73
commit 8317202e3d
8 changed files with 39 additions and 40 deletions

View File

@ -3,7 +3,7 @@
apiVersion: batch/v1 apiVersion: batch/v1
kind: Job kind: Job
metadata: metadata:
name: glance-init name: glance-db-init
spec: spec:
template: template:
metadata: metadata:
@ -16,8 +16,8 @@ spec:
nodeSelector: nodeSelector:
{{ .Values.labels.node_selector_key }}: {{ .Values.labels.node_selector_value }} {{ .Values.labels.node_selector_key }}: {{ .Values.labels.node_selector_value }}
containers: containers:
- name: glance-init - name: glance-db-init
image: {{ .Values.images.init }} image: {{ .Values.images.db_init }}
imagePullPolicy: {{ .Values.images.pull_policy }} imagePullPolicy: {{ .Values.images.pull_policy }}
env: env:
- name: ANSIBLE_LIBRARY - name: ANSIBLE_LIBRARY

View File

@ -16,9 +16,9 @@ labels:
node_selector_value: enabled node_selector_value: enabled
images: images:
db_init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
db_sync: quay.io/stackanetes/stackanetes-glance-api:newton db_sync: quay.io/stackanetes/stackanetes-glance-api:newton
api: quay.io/stackanetes/stackanetes-glance-api:newton api: quay.io/stackanetes/stackanetes-glance-api:newton
init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
registry: quay.io/stackanetes/stackanetes-glance-registry:newton registry: quay.io/stackanetes/stackanetes-glance-registry:newton
post: quay.io/stackanetes/stackanetes-kolla-toolbox:newton post: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
dep_check: quay.io/stackanetes/kubernetes-entrypoint:v0.1.0 dep_check: quay.io/stackanetes/kubernetes-entrypoint:v0.1.0
@ -75,7 +75,7 @@ misc:
dependencies: dependencies:
api: api:
jobs: jobs:
- glance-init - glance-db-init
- glance-db-sync - glance-db-sync
- keystone-db-sync - keystone-db-sync
service: service:
@ -83,7 +83,7 @@ dependencies:
- mariadb - mariadb
registry: registry:
jobs: jobs:
- glance-init - glance-db-init
- glance-db-sync - glance-db-sync
- keystone-db-sync - keystone-db-sync
service: service:
@ -92,9 +92,9 @@ dependencies:
- glance-api - glance-api
db_sync: db_sync:
jobs: jobs:
- keystone-init - keystone-db-init
- keystone-db-sync - keystone-db-sync
- glance-init - glance-db-init
- mariadb-seed - mariadb-seed
service: service:
- mariadb - mariadb
@ -105,10 +105,10 @@ dependencies:
- mariadb - mariadb
post: post:
jobs: jobs:
- glance-init - glance-db-init
- glance-db-sync - glance-db-sync
- keystone-db-sync - keystone-db-sync
- keystone-init - keystone-db-init
- mariadb-seed - mariadb-seed
service: service:
- mariadb - mariadb
@ -138,4 +138,3 @@ endpoints:
port: port:
admin: 35357 admin: 35357
public: 5000 public: 5000

View File

@ -3,7 +3,7 @@
apiVersion: batch/v1 apiVersion: batch/v1
kind: Job kind: Job
metadata: metadata:
name: keystone-init name: keystone-db-init
spec: spec:
template: template:
metadata: metadata:
@ -16,8 +16,8 @@ spec:
nodeSelector: nodeSelector:
{{ .Values.labels.node_selector_key }}: {{ .Values.labels.node_selector_value }} {{ .Values.labels.node_selector_key }}: {{ .Values.labels.node_selector_value }}
containers: containers:
- name: keystone-init - name: keystone-db-init
image: {{ .Values.images.init }} image: {{ .Values.images.db_init }}
imagePullPolicy: {{ .Values.images.pull_policy }} imagePullPolicy: {{ .Values.images.pull_policy }}
command: command:
- bash - bash

View File

@ -10,9 +10,9 @@ labels:
node_selector_value: enabled node_selector_value: enabled
images: images:
db_init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
db_sync: quay.io/stackanetes/stackanetes-keystone-api:newton db_sync: quay.io/stackanetes/stackanetes-keystone-api:newton
api: quay.io/stackanetes/stackanetes-keystone-api:newton api: quay.io/stackanetes/stackanetes-keystone-api:newton
init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
dep_check: quay.io/stackanetes/kubernetes-entrypoint:v0.1.0 dep_check: quay.io/stackanetes/kubernetes-entrypoint:v0.1.0
pull_policy: "IfNotPresent" pull_policy: "IfNotPresent"
@ -67,7 +67,7 @@ dependencies:
- mariadb - mariadb
db_sync: db_sync:
jobs: jobs:
- keystone-init - keystone-db-init
- mariadb-seed - mariadb-seed
service: service:
- mariadb - mariadb

View File

@ -3,7 +3,7 @@
apiVersion: batch/v1 apiVersion: batch/v1
kind: Job kind: Job
metadata: metadata:
name: neutron-init name: neutron-db-init
spec: spec:
template: template:
metadata: metadata:
@ -16,8 +16,8 @@ spec:
nodeSelector: nodeSelector:
{{ .Values.labels.server.node_selector_key }}: {{ .Values.labels.server.node_selector_value }} {{ .Values.labels.server.node_selector_key }}: {{ .Values.labels.server.node_selector_value }}
containers: containers:
- name: neutron-init - name: neutron-db-init
image: {{ .Values.images.init }} image: {{ .Values.images.db_init }}
imagePullPolicy: {{ .Values.images.pull_policy }} imagePullPolicy: {{ .Values.images.pull_policy }}
command: command:
- bash - bash

View File

@ -7,7 +7,7 @@ replicas:
server: 1 server: 1
images: images:
init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ton db_init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
db_sync: quay.io/stackanetes/stackanetes-neutron-server:newton db_sync: quay.io/stackanetes/stackanetes-neutron-server:newton
server: quay.io/stackanetes/stackanetes-neutron-server:newton server: quay.io/stackanetes/stackanetes-neutron-server:newton
dhcp: quay.io/stackanetes/stackanetes-neutron-dhcp-agent:newton dhcp: quay.io/stackanetes/stackanetes-neutron-dhcp-agent:newton
@ -151,7 +151,7 @@ dependencies:
- rabbitmq - rabbitmq
- nova-api - nova-api
jobs: jobs:
- neutron-init - neutron-db-init
- nova-post - nova-post
daemonset: daemonset:
- ovs-agent - ovs-agent
@ -160,7 +160,7 @@ dependencies:
- rabbitmq - rabbitmq
- nova-api - nova-api
jobs: jobs:
- neutron-init - neutron-db-init
- nova-post - nova-post
daemonset: daemonset:
- ovs-agent - ovs-agent
@ -178,8 +178,8 @@ dependencies:
- rabbitmq - rabbitmq
- nova-api - nova-api
jobs: jobs:
- nova-init - nova-db-init
- neutron-init - neutron-db-init
- nova-post - nova-post
daemonset: daemonset:
- ovs-agent - ovs-agent

View File

@ -3,7 +3,7 @@
apiVersion: batch/v1 apiVersion: batch/v1
kind: Job kind: Job
metadata: metadata:
name: nova-init name: nova-db-init
spec: spec:
template: template:
metadata: metadata:
@ -16,8 +16,8 @@ spec:
nodeSelector: nodeSelector:
{{ .Values.labels.control_node_selector_key }}: {{ .Values.labels.control_node_selector_value }} {{ .Values.labels.control_node_selector_key }}: {{ .Values.labels.control_node_selector_value }}
containers: containers:
- name: nova-init - name: nova-db-init
image: {{ .Values.images.init }} image: {{ .Values.images.db_init }}
imagePullPolicy: {{ .Values.images.pull_policy }} imagePullPolicy: {{ .Values.images.pull_policy }}
command: command:
- bash - bash

View File

@ -13,7 +13,7 @@ control_replicas: 1
compute_replicas: 1 compute_replicas: 1
images: images:
init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ton db_init: quay.io/stackanetes/stackanetes-kolla-toolbox:newton
db_sync: quay.io/stackanetes/stackanetes-nova-api:newton db_sync: quay.io/stackanetes/stackanetes-nova-api:newton
api: quay.io/stackanetes/stackanetes-nova-api:newton api: quay.io/stackanetes/stackanetes-nova-api:newton
conductor: quay.io/stackanetes/stackanetes-nova-conductor:newton conductor: quay.io/stackanetes/stackanetes-nova-conductor:newton
@ -110,29 +110,29 @@ dependencies:
api: api:
jobs: jobs:
- keystone-db-sync - keystone-db-sync
- nova-init - nova-db-init
- nova-db-sync - nova-db-sync
service: service:
- mariadb - mariadb
db_sync: db_sync:
jobs: jobs:
- nova-init - nova-db-init
- keystone-init - keystone-db-init
- mariadb-seed - mariadb-seed
service: service:
- mariadb - mariadb
db_sync: db_sync:
jobs: jobs:
- nova-init - nova-db-init
- keystone-init - keystone-db-init
- mariadb-seed - mariadb-seed
- keystone-db-sync - keystone-db-sync
service: service:
- mariadb - mariadb
post: post:
jobs: jobs:
- nova-init - nova-db-init
- keystone-init - keystone-db-init
- mariadb-seed - mariadb-seed
service: service:
- mariadb - mariadb
@ -152,7 +152,7 @@ dependencies:
- ovs-agent - ovs-agent
libvirt: libvirt:
jobs: jobs:
- nova-init - nova-db-init
- nova-post - nova-post
- nova-db-sync - nova-db-sync
service: service:
@ -162,7 +162,7 @@ dependencies:
jobs: jobs:
- mariadb-seed - mariadb-seed
- keystone-db-sync - keystone-db-sync
- nova-init - nova-db-init
- nova-db-sync - nova-db-sync
service: service:
- mariadb - mariadb